Patent Cooperation Treaty (PCT) Processes
The PCT processes streamline the international patent application procedure, facilitating filings for mechanical patents across multiple jurisdictions. This process allows applicants to seek patent protection simultaneously in numerous countries through a single international application.
Applicants initially file a PCT application with their national or regional patent office, which then acts as an international receiving office. The application undergoes an international search and examination phase, which can take up to 18 months from the priority date. This step provides a written opinion on patentability, aiding strategic decisions.
The International Bureau (IB) of the World Intellectual Property Organization (WIPO) manages the subsequent stages. After the international phase, applicants enter the national or regional phase, where they must meet regional requirements and deadlines for each jurisdiction. Key points include:
- Deadline for entering regional phases typically ranges from 30 to 31 months from the priority date.
- Applicants must provide translations, pay fees, and comply with local patent laws.
- These procedures ensure consistent application processing and effective management of patent priority claims across multiple jurisdictions.

Timing and Deadlines for Priority Claims
Timing and deadlines are critical factors in establishing and maintaining the validity of mechanical patent priority claims. The primary deadline is typically within 12 months from the filing date of the initial application, known as the priority year. Missing this window can result in the loss of the priority right, adversely affecting patent scope and enforceability.
Key considerations include:
- The exact date of the first filing must be clearly documented and verifiable.
- Subsequent filings must specify the earlier application to claim priority.
- Deadlines apply across jurisdictions and may vary slightly among regional patent offices, necessitating careful planning.
Filing strategies should also account for potential delays or procedural issues, ensuring the priority claim is explicitly requested and supported by appropriate documentation. Staying aware of individual regional deadlines and international agreements helps in effectively managing timing and avoiding pitfalls in mechanical patent priority claims.
